A robust cell‐responsive hydrogel photoresist, based on peptide‐crosslinked poly(vinyl alcohol), is demonstrated by Xiao‐Hua Qin and co‐workers in article number 1705564. This material enables spatiotemporal construction and manipulation of 3D cellular environments at micrometer‐scale resolution. By focusing a multiphoton laser, cell‐adhesive ligands are site‐specifically immobilized in a 3D matrix...
Advanced hydrogel systems that allow precise control of cells and their 3D microenvironments are needed in tissue engineering, disease modeling, and drug screening. Multiphoton lithography (MPL) allows true 3D microfabrication of complex objects, but its biological application requires a cell‐compatible hydrogel resist that is sufficiently photosensitive, cell‐degradable, and permissive to support...
